Absolutely! The Certificate III in Pathology Collection is designed for beginners, making it an ideal choice for those with no prior experience in healthcare. The course covers foundational skills like venepuncture, specimen handling, and workplace safety, while also developing soft skills like patient communication. Clinical placements provide hands-on experience, allowing students to apply their knowledge in real healthcare settings. Many graduates start with no background in healthcare but leave feeling confident and job-ready.While further training would be required for career advancement, pathology collection is an excellent doorway to the healthcare industry for those who have no industry experience.

Missing veins is a common part of learning to perform venepuncture, and every student experiences it during training. Sarah Knuckey from Lab Tech Training told us that students start on silicone arms to build basic techniques before advancing to supervised practice on peers. Instructors provide detailed feedback to help students improve and gain confidence. Mistakes are treated as learning opportunities, not failures. With time, repetition, and expert guidance, students develop the precision and confidence needed to perform venepuncture effectively in real-world settings.

If you're looking to kickstart your career in pathology, Mount Cottrell offers an array of courses tailored for both beginners and experienced learners. With 26 Pathology courses available, you can choose from vocational education and training, higher education, or short courses. For those just starting out, beginner courses like the Certificate III in Pathology Collection HLT37215, Certificate III in Allied Health Assistance HLT33021, and Collect Specimens for Drugs of Abuse Testing HLTPAT005 provide a solid foundation in pathology. These qualifications can lead to entry-level job roles such as pathology collector and allied health assistant.
For those with prior qualifications or experience, the Mount Cottrell region is home to advanced courses that can elevate your skills to new heights. Options include the Certificate IV in Laboratory Techniques MSL40122, Bachelor of Nursing, and Bachelor of Health Science. These advanced qualifications cater to roles such as laboratory technician, health researcher, or clinical aromatherapist, giving you the tools to excel in your career within the health sector.
Local training providers such as ETEA, Mayfield Education, and TAA are dedicated to delivering quality education right in Mount Cottrell. Other respected institutions like Deakin University and Monash University also have a strong presence in the area, offering numerous pathways for students looking to excel in pathology and health science fields.
